Guaranteeing Building Safety And Security



Enhancing building and construction safety through extensive procedures is extremely important in the effective implementation of structure tasks. When it concerns guaranteeing building security, concrete scanning plays a critical duty. By utilizing innovative scanning innovations, such as ground-penetrating radar (GPR) and electro-magnetic induction, construction teams can properly situate rebar, avenues, and various other concealed dangers within concrete structures. This information is vital for protecting against crashes throughout boring, cutting, or demolition activities.


Concrete scanning not just helps recognize potential dangers within the framework however also help in preparing the job refines more successfully. RainierGPR Concrete Scanning. By understanding the precise areas of embedded things, building groups can take needed precautions and apply safety procedures to mitigate this contact form dangers. This article proactive strategy considerably reduces the probability of onsite incidents, making sure the health of workers and the total success of the project




Additionally, by prioritizing building safety and security with concrete scanning, task managers demonstrate their dedication to conference regulatory demands and market criteria. Buying precaution like concrete scanning ultimately causes a smoother construction process and a much safer workplace for all involved.


Comprehensive Insights and Evaluation





Concrete scanning's thorough insights and analysis supply vital details for informed decision-making in building and construction projects. By using innovative innovation such as ground-penetrating radar (GPR) and electromagnetic induction, concrete scanning can spot rebar, post-tension wires, conduits, and spaces within frameworks. This level of comprehensive details allows building experts to plan efficiently, staying clear of expensive blunders and possible safety and security dangers.


In addition, the thorough understandings given by concrete scanning assistance in analyzing the architectural stability of existing concrete aspects. By determining locations of damage, cracks, or other flaws non-destructively, designers can prioritize repairs and upkeep, expanding the life expectancy of the framework.


The analysis derived from concrete scanning additionally aids in as-built documentation, providing exact information on the area of architectural elements for future reference. This documentation is vital for remodelling or development tasks, ensuring that new construction integrates flawlessly with existing structures.
